White Chicken Chili

  •   Easy  
  • Ready in: 1 hour

  • Prep: 10 mins  Cook: 20 mins
  • Extra time: 30 mins
  • Serves: 4
Smooth and Spicy... Great with corn bread!

Ingredients

1 Rotisserie Chicken (Pre-Cooked)
1 Medium Onion
1.5 Teaspoons Garlic Powder
2 Cans Great Northern Beans
14 Ounces Chicken Broth (Canned or Boxed)
1 Can Green Chilis
1 Teaspoon Salt
1 Teaspoon Ground Cumin
1 Teaspoon Dried Oregano
1/2 Teaspoon Black Pepper
1/4 Teaspoon Crushed Red Pepper
Pinch Cayenne Pepper
8 Ounces Sour Cream
1/2 Cup Whipping Cream

Preparation method

1. Open all cans, drain and rinse beans, and strip chicken from bone. Skin is optional (I leave it out)
2. Chop chicken and onion
3. Put chicken, beans, chicken broth, chilis, onion, and seasonings in large pot or crockpot. Bring to boil, and let simmer until onions are done.
4. Turn off heat. Add sour cream and whipping cream. Mix and serve right away.

Tip

Don't get carried away with the cayenne, it's easy to over do it!
